NAME¶
freefoam-formatConvert - Converts all IOobjects associated with a case into the format specified in the controlDict.SYNOPSIS¶
freefoam formatConvert [-help] [-latestTime] [-noZero] [-srcDoc] [-doc] [-time <time>] [-constant] [-parallel] [-case <dir>]DESCRIPTION¶
Mainly used to convert binary mesh/field files to ASCII. Bugs Any zero-size List written binary gets written as 0. When reading the file as a dictionary this is interpreted as a label. This is (usually) not a problem when doing patch fields since these get the uniform, nonuniform prefix. However zone contents are labelLists not labelFields and these go wrong. For now hacked a solution where we detect the keywords in zones and redo the dictionary entries to be labelLists.OPTIONS¶
